# Leo Hessianai 7B Chat - AWQ - Model creator: [LAION LeoLM](https://huggingface.co/LeoLM) - Original model: [Leo Hessianai 7B Chat](https://huggingface.co/L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b-chat) ## Description This repo contains AWQ model files for [LAION LeoLM's Leo Hessianai 7B Chat](https://huggingface.co/L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b-chat). ### About AWQ AWQ is an efficient, accurate and blazing-fast low-bit weight quantization method, currently supporting 4-bit quantization. Compared to GPTQ, it offers faster Transformers-based inference. It is also now supported by continuous batching server [vLLM](https://github.com/vllm-project/vllm), allowing use of Llama AWQ models for high-throughput concurrent inference in multi-user server scenarios. As of September 25th 2023, preliminary Llama-only AWQ support has also been added to [Huggingface Text Generation Inference (TGI)](https://github.com/huggingface/text-generation-inference). Note that, at the time of writing, overall throughput is still lower than running vLLM or TGI with unquantised models, however using AWQ enables using much smaller GPUs which can lead to easier deployment and overall cost savings. And thank you again to a16z for their generous grant. # Original model card: LAION LeoLM's Leo Hessianai 7B Chat # LAION LeoLM: **L**inguistically **E**nhanced **O**pen **L**anguage **M**odel Meet LeoLM, the first open and commercially available German Foundation Language Model built on Llama-2. Our models extend Llama-2's capabilities into German through continued pretraining on a large corpus of German-language and mostly locality specific text. Thanks to a compute grant at HessianAI's new supercomputer **42**, we release two foundation models trained with 8k context length, [`L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b`](https://huggingface.co/L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b) and [`LeoLM/leo-hessianai-13b`](https://huggingface.co/LeoLM/leo-hessianai-13b) under the [Llama-2 community license](https://huggingface.co/meta-llama/Llama-2-70b/raw/main/LICENSE.txt) (70b also coming soon! 👀). With this release, we hope to bring a new wave of opportunities to German open-source and commercial LLM research and accelerate adoption. Read our [blog post]() or our paper (preprint coming soon) for more details! *A project by Björn Plüster and Christoph Schuhmann in collaboration with LAION and HessianAI.* ## LeoLM Chat `L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b-chat` is a German chat model built on our foundation model `LeoLM/leo-hessianai-7b` and finetuned on a selection of German instruction datasets. The model performs exceptionally well on writing, explanation and discussion tasks but struggles somewhat with math and advanced reasoning.
